(On-Site Releases): Flow increased in 2011 compared to 2010 due to higher rainfall and hence inflow. The effluent ammonia concentration increased in 2011 to 1.7 mg/l compared to 1.5 mg/l in There were no by-passes in 2010 compared to 2011 which was a wet year. By-passes of secondary treatment do not nitrify and so have contributed to increased ammonia releases. The average ammonia concentration in the Thames River downstream of the Adelaide wastewater treatment plant was 0.13 mg/l in 2010 and 0.14 mg/l in 2011.
